ADB and JICA agree $1.5bn private infrastructure fund

Region:
Asia-Pacific

The Asian Development Bank (ADB) has entered into an agreement with the Japan International Cooperation Agency (JICA) to support private infrastructure investments across Asia and the Pacific. The fund will be capitalised by $1.5 billion in equity from JICA.
